HOUSTON — Texas Children’s Hospital, in collaboration with FKP Architects, will add a $506 million, 19-story patient tower to its campus as part of a $575 million capital investment. The new tower will sit on top of an existing six-story base adjacent to Texas Children’s Pavilion for Women. FKP’s Houston office will lead planning and design for the project, which is expected to be complete in 2018. Pediatric Tower E will initially offer 129 beds for pediatric and cardiovascular intensive care, along with new operating rooms. It will also be the home of the relocated Texas Children’s Heart Center, including a new outpatient clinic, cardiovascular operating rooms, dedicated cardiology beds and catheterization labs. The Heart Center will move out of the West Tower, making way for additional acute care beds. The project will be funded in part from the Texas Children’s Promise Campaign.

CHERRY HILL, N.J. — NAI Mertz has brokered three transactions in Cherry Hill. In the first transaction, Byrn Mawr Investments purchased a 28,000-square-foot office building, located at 706 Haddonfield Road, from Multiple Sclerosis Association of America for an undisclosed price. The buyer plans to redevelop the property into retail use by demolishing a portion of the building and converting it into parking spaces. Jeff Sloan of NAI Mertz negotiated the transaction. Sloan also represented Multiple Sclerosis Association of America in the acquisition of a 14,400-square-foot office building located at 375 N. Kings Highway. The seller was 375 NKH LLC. In the third deal, SportsArena Employees 137 Welfare Fund sold a two-story 11,683-square-foot office building, located at 1012 Haddonfield Road, to Several Properties and First American Exchange. Marc Cutler and John Brown of NAI Mertz were the sole brokers in the transaction. The prices for the transactions were not released.

BOCA RATON, FLA. — CBRE has brokered the $23.8 million sale of Glades Twin Plaza, a 98,312-square-foot boutique office building located at 2300 Glades Road in Boca Raton. Built in 1982 and renovated in 2010, the office property was 77 percent leased at the time of sale. Christian Lee, Jose Lobon, Charles Foschini, Chris Apone and Michael Erickson of CBRE represented the seller, a fund managed by BlackRock, in the transaction. The buyer was Dallas-based L&B Realty Advisors.

CHARLOTTE, N.C. — Co-owners Grubb Properties and New York Life Real Estate Investors have signed Frontier Capital, a growth equity firm based in North Carolina, to a long-term lease for the top floor of 525 North Tryon Street, a 19-story office building in Uptown Charlotte. Frontier will use the 12,600-square-foot space as its new headquarters beginning in September. Andy Horsey of Cresa Charlotte represented Frontier Capital in the lease transaction. Jonathan Nance of Grubb Properties, along with Meredith Ball and Mark Holoman of Cushman & Wakefield | Thalhimer, represented the ownership group.

NEW YORK CITY — RKF has brokered the sale of a 19,008-square-foot commercial condominium located at 100 West 93rd St. on the Upper West Side in New York City. Coltown Properties acquired the property for $16.5 million and subsequently leased the property to Manhattan Children’s Center, a school that provides scientifically based treatment and education to children with autism spectrum disorders. The two-story asset features 13,834 square feet on the ground floor and 5,174 square feet on the second floor. David Abrams and Marc Finkel of RKF represented the buyer, while Michael Dubin of Savvit Partners represented the seller, Starrett Development. Additionally, Abrams and Finkel represented both parties in the lease transaction.

DALLAS — CBRE Capital Markets’ Investment Properties has arranged the sale of NBCUniversal Regional Headquarters, a 75,000-square-foot, single-story Class A office asset in Dallas. The LEED-certified building was completed in 2013. The property is fully leased to NBCUniversal Media LLC, a wholly owned subsidiary of Comcast Corp., and serves as the regional headquarters, broadcasting and multimedia news facility for NBC/KXAS-TV, Telemundo and NBCUniversal. Olympus Ventures purchased the asset from KDC for an undisclosed price. Eric Mackey, Gary Carr, John Alvarado, Robert Hill and Pete Van Amburgh of CBRE represented the seller.

PHOENIX — A partnership between Lincoln Property Company (LPC) and funds managed by Oaktree Capital Management has acquired Biltmore Commerce Center, a 259,000-square-foot office property in Phoenix, for $58 million. The Class A center is located at 3200 E. Camelback Road in the Camelback Corridor. The three-story property is currently 93 percent leased to tenants like HDR Engineering, Lee & Associates, United Way, Greystar, North American Title Company and Miller Russell & Associates. It is situated across the street from two retail projects that feature tenants like Central Bistro, Wells Fargo, Bank of America, Mexx 32, Tarbell’s, Tommy V’s Osteria and Pizzeria, Tomaso’s and Hava Java Café. Biltmore Commerce Center includes a newly remodeled, 11,000-square-foot, three-story atrium. It recently had its corridors and lobbies remodeled, in addition to upgraded landscaping and a new water feature. The seller, a joint venture between DPC Development Company and Bridge Investment Group, was represented by Chris Toci, Chad Littell, Jerry Noble, Pat Devine and Greg Mayer of Cushman & Wakefield. The institutional-quality office building’s property management strategy will be directed by LPC’s Alisa Timm.

HANOVER, N.J. — A joint venture between Vision Real Estate Partners and Rubenstein Partners has broken ground for the construction of a global headquarters for MetLife Investments in Hanover. Situated on 14 acres within 67 Whippany Road’s South Campus component, the 185,000-square-foot property will feature an open floor plan with collaborative workspaces and breakout rooms, a town hall with technologically advanced conference facilities, a fitness center, employee food court with indoor and outdoor seating, and a café. Additionally, the property will offer 4.5 parking spaces per 1,000 feet of rentable area. The property is also designed to achieve LEED Gold Core and Shell and LEED Platinum Interiors certifications. Bruce Mosler, Ethan Silverstein, David Susoreny, Bill Brown and Andrew Merin of Cushman & Wakefield represented MetLife in the transaction. Robert Donnelly and Robert Donnelly Jr., also of Cushman & Wakefield, represented the property ownership in the lease transaction.
